云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

廣州作為中國(guó)的科技中心之一,擁有大量的機(jī)會(huì)和資源來(lái)學(xué)習(xí)PHP編程。PHP是一種廣泛使用的開(kāi)源腳本語(yǔ)言,尤其在Web開(kāi)發(fā)中非常流行。如果你想快速掌握PHP編程的關(guān)鍵技巧,以下是一個(gè)指南,可以幫助你開(kāi)始學(xué)習(xí)之旅。
### 1. 了解PHP基礎(chǔ)
- **學(xué)習(xí)PHP語(yǔ)法**:了解基本的PHP語(yǔ)法,包括如何聲明變量、使用數(shù)據(jù)類(lèi)型、執(zhí)行條件語(yǔ)句和循環(huán)等。
- **熟悉PHP函數(shù)**:學(xué)習(xí)如何使用內(nèi)置的PHP函數(shù)來(lái)執(zhí)行常見(jiàn)的任務(wù),如字符串操作、數(shù)組處理和文件操作等。
- **理解對(duì)象和面向?qū)ο缶幊?*:學(xué)習(xí)如何創(chuàng)建類(lèi)和對(duì)象,以及如何使用繼承、多態(tài)和接口等面向?qū)ο蟮母拍睢?br>
### 2. 學(xué)習(xí)Web開(kāi)發(fā)基礎(chǔ)
- **HTML和CSS**:了解如何創(chuàng)建網(wǎng)頁(yè)的基本結(jié)構(gòu)和使用CSS進(jìn)行樣式設(shè)計(jì)。
- **JavaScript**:學(xué)習(xí)如何使用JavaScript進(jìn)行客戶(hù)端交互,這對(duì)理解服務(wù)器端編程如PHP很有幫助。
- **HTTP協(xié)議**:理解HTTP協(xié)議的工作原理,這對(duì)理解Web請(qǐng)求和響應(yīng)至關(guān)重要。
### 3. 使用PHP框架
- **選擇一個(gè)框架**:選擇一個(gè)流行的PHP框架,如Laravel、Symfony、CodeIgniter或Yii等。
- **學(xué)習(xí)框架文檔**:仔細(xì)閱讀框架的文檔,了解它的架構(gòu)、安裝過(guò)程、常用組件和路由系統(tǒng)等。
- **構(gòu)建項(xiàng)目**:通過(guò)實(shí)際的項(xiàng)目來(lái)學(xué)習(xí),這有助于加深對(duì)框架的理解和應(yīng)用。
### 4. 實(shí)踐項(xiàng)目
- **開(kāi)始小型項(xiàng)目**:從簡(jiǎn)單的網(wǎng)站開(kāi)始,如個(gè)人簡(jiǎn)歷網(wǎng)站、博客系統(tǒng)或社交媒體分析工具等。
- **參與開(kāi)源項(xiàng)目**:加入一個(gè)開(kāi)源的PHP項(xiàng)目,如WordPress、Drupal或PrestaShop等,貢獻(xiàn)代碼并學(xué)習(xí)他人的最佳實(shí)踐。
- **建立在線作品集**:創(chuàng)建一個(gè)在線作品集,展示你的PHP項(xiàng)目,這不僅有助于學(xué)習(xí),還能建立你的專(zhuān)業(yè)形象。
### 5. 學(xué)習(xí)數(shù)據(jù)庫(kù)操作
- **選擇數(shù)據(jù)庫(kù)**:了解不同的數(shù)據(jù)庫(kù)管理系統(tǒng),如MySQL、PostgreSQL或SQLite等。
- **學(xué)習(xí)SQL**:學(xué)習(xí)如何使用SQL語(yǔ)言進(jìn)行數(shù)據(jù)庫(kù)查詢(xún)、插入、更新和刪除操作。
- **對(duì)象關(guān)系映射(ORM)**:學(xué)習(xí)如何使用ORM工具,如Laravel的Eloquent或Doctrine等,來(lái)簡(jiǎn)化數(shù)據(jù)庫(kù)操作。
### 6. 提升技能
- **學(xué)習(xí)版本控制**:掌握版本控制工具,如Git,這對(duì)于團(tuán)隊(duì)合作和代碼管理至關(guān)重要。
- **了解安全性**:學(xué)習(xí)如何保護(hù)你的PHP應(yīng)用免受常見(jiàn)的攻擊,如跨站腳本(XSS)、跨站請(qǐng)求偽造(CSRF)和SQL注入等。
- **性能優(yōu)化**:學(xué)習(xí)如何優(yōu)化PHP代碼和數(shù)據(jù)庫(kù)查詢(xún)以提高應(yīng)用的性能。
### 7. 加入社區(qū)
- **參加本地聚會(huì)**:加入廣州的PHP用戶(hù)組或參加相關(guān)的技術(shù)聚會(huì),與其他開(kāi)發(fā)者交流學(xué)習(xí)。
- **在線社區(qū)**:加入Stack Overflow、GitHub和Reddit等在線社區(qū),提問(wèn)和回答問(wèn)題,與其他開(kāi)發(fā)者建立聯(lián)系。
### 8. 持續(xù)學(xué)習(xí)
- **閱讀書(shū)籍和文章**:閱讀關(guān)于PHP編程的書(shū)籍和文章,以加深理解并獲取新的知識(shí)。
- **觀看教程和視頻**:利用在線教程、視頻課程和會(huì)議演講來(lái)學(xué)習(xí)新的技巧和最佳實(shí)踐。
- **參加培訓(xùn)課程**:如果預(yù)算允許,可以考慮參加由專(zhuān)業(yè)人士提供的PHP培訓(xùn)課程。
通過(guò)上述步驟,你可以逐步建立起PHP編程的知識(shí)和技能。記住,編程是一個(gè)不斷學(xué)習(xí)和實(shí)踐的過(guò)程,保持好奇心和求知欲,不斷嘗試新的事物,你將能夠快速掌握PHP編程的關(guān)鍵技巧。